The intent

When a space needs to feel alive, not lit

Some briefs aren’t about brightness or colour — they’re about life. A reception that should feel like it sits underwater. A restaurant wall that flickers like a real fire. A ceiling that drifts with cloud. The moment movement repeats or reads as a video loop, the illusion breaks.

The instinct is often to reach for a screen or a media server. But screens announce themselves, loops become obvious, and haze-based effects need atmosphere to be visible. Rosco’s X-Effects takes a different route: it generates movement optically, with two independently-rotating glass effect discs, so the pattern layers over itself and never repeats in a way the eye can catch.

The result is movement that behaves like the real thing — and lands on a real surface, at architectural scale, from a fixture you can conceal.

How it’s made

Movement generated in glass, not on a screen

Two-disc optical animation

Independently rotating effect glass discs layer over each other, so water, fire and cloud move organically and never resolve into a visible loop.

Real light on real surfaces

The effect is projected onto architecture — walls, floors, ceilings, water features — not confined to a display panel or emissive screen.

Bright enough to hold up

Designed to stay legible in real environments, including spaces with significant ambient and projected light around it.

Reference project

15,000 sq ft of moving water

For The Blue Paradox — an immersive ocean-conservation exhibit at Chicago’s Museum of Science and Industry — the brief was a feeling: visitors should sense they had stepped beneath the surface of the sea.

Roughly 200 Rosco X-Effects projectors layer non-repeating water across the environment, bright and convincing enough to hold their own against heavy ambient projection. No two moments look quite the same.

Designing it in

What to think about early

A few decisions shape how convincing and how concealed the effect will be. CFATS can test these with you on the actual surface before anything is specified.

Effect & disc choice

Water, fire, cloud, foliage and other effects are set by the glass effect discs selected — the starting point for the look you want.

Surface & scale

The receiving surface, throw distance and coverage area determine fixture count and lens choice. Larger fields simply layer more projectors.

Ambient light

How much competing light sits in the space affects perceived contrast. We assess this against the real conditions, not a datasheet.

Concealment & mounting

Because the source is a discrete projector, it can usually be hidden — mounting, sightlines and access are worth resolving up front.
